On 12/28/06, Sean Donelan <sean@donelan.com> wrote:

> Don't forget the biggie.  These are "shared use facilities."  People who
> buy space in collocation facilities already have lower security
> requirements.  The only thing keeping the "bad guys" out is whether
> their payment clears.
>
> Security by poverty?

Very true. If you have an application that requires a high level of
security, in a perfect world you'd have the budget to put it in your
own facility where you control physical access, not outsourced
security from a colo vendor.
